Team GB’s first gold medallist of the Rio 2016 Olympics, Adam Peaty, is to receive a homecoming parade fit for a hero in his birthplace of Uttoxeter.

Record breaking Peaty will travel through the streets of Uttoxeter on an open top bus on Saturday 1st October to thank fans for all the support given over the last few years and in particular during the Olympics.

Adam is looking to forward to meeting as many people as possible as he travels around his Staffordshire hometown and joined by his family and friends.

Everyone is invited to line the streets, waving their flags and hanging their bunting in celebration to commemorate the wonderful achievements of Uttoxeter’s Olympic Gold and Silver Medallist.

The open top bus tour will commence at 11am on Saturday 1 October 2016 from Byrds Lane, Uttoxeter
